Output 3fb31d624c9bb17161a097bd45408fff4f33600e8fadf48973657c07b24b8c50:1

value
82677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 971c520111c0a4bb453000a4a3cec3087c483bb1 OP_EQUAL
address
3FU1tEwHDHJ63Z1xsCQA1cuz4khPD4z511
transaction
3fb31d624c9bb17161a097bd45408fff4f33600e8fadf48973657c07b24b8c50
confirmations
504964
spent
true